Another pond restored by the Wensum Farmers is Health Pit; a very ancient pit which leads onto the next landowners area of land – great for connectivity in the landscape! The pit was between 75-100% shaded prior to restoration but held around one foot of water. The restoration took place on the 21st September 2019, during which finches, long-tailed tits, great tits and blue tits were spotted in the area – definitely a lovely sight to keep the spirits up when you’re undertaking hard work as our NPP contractors were.
Post restoration you can clearly see where the digger has got back to the marl layer on the banks of the pond.
